Marketplace Advantages: What Is an Online Marketplace?

An online marketplace is a platform on the internet where various providers can offer their products or services. Unlike traditional retail stores that sell their own goods, the marketplace acts as an intermediary between sellers and buyers. Well-known examples of such platforms include Amazon, eBay, Etsy, and Alibaba.

Advantage 1: Large Reach

One of the biggest advantages of online marketplaces is the enormous reach. Sellers can reach customers worldwide without needing to open physical stores. This global presence allows sellers to expand into new markets and grow their customer base.

Advantage 2: Lower Operating Costs

Compared to physical stores, operating costs on an online marketplace are often significantly lower. Sellers save on rent, personnel, and physical storage costs. These savings can be passed on to customers in the form of lower prices, which can in turn boost sales.

Advantage 3: Easy Access to a Broad Customer Base

Online marketplaces give sellers access to an already established customer base. Large platforms have millions of users who regularly search for products. This means sellers can benefit from the visibility and trust these platforms have already built.

Advantage 4: User-Friendliness and Convenience

For buyers, online marketplaces offer a convenient way to browse and purchase a wide variety of products in one place. Simple navigation, search features, and filtering options help customers find exactly what they’re looking for—often at competitive prices.

Step 5: Secure Transactions

Many online marketplaces offer integrated payment systems that ensure secure transactions. Buyers can be confident their payment information is protected, while sellers can receive payments quickly and reliably.

Step 6: Reviews and Feedback

Customer reviews and feedback systems are a key part of online marketplaces. They allow buyers to make informed decisions and help sellers build trust and continuously improve their products and services.

Disadvantage 1: High Competitive Pressure

One of the biggest disadvantages of online marketplaces is the intense competition. Since many sellers offer similar or identical products, it can be difficult to stand out. This can lead to price wars that erode sellers’ profit margins.

Disadvantage 2: Fees and Commissions

Although operating costs are generally lower, many online marketplaces charge fees for listing products and commissions on sales. These costs can quickly add up and affect a seller’s profitability.

Disadvantage 3: Dependence on the Platform

Sellers who operate exclusively on an online marketplace can become highly dependent on the platform’s rules and guidelines. Changes in algorithms, fee structures, or terms of service can significantly impact a seller’s business.

Disadvantage 4: Less Control Over Branding

On an online marketplace, sellers often have less control over branding and product presentation. The standardized layouts and design guidelines of the platforms can make it difficult to create a unique brand identity.

Disadvantage 5: Challenges with Customer Loyalty

Because customers are often influenced by price comparisons and reviews, it can be difficult for sellers to build a loyal customer base. Customers can quickly switch to another provider if it offers a better price or better reviews.

Disadvantage 6: Risk of Fraud and Returns

Although online marketplaces have security measures in place, there is always a risk of fraud. Sellers can suffer losses from fraudulent returns or unauthorized transactions. The return policies many platforms offer can also pose challenges, especially if they’re misused.
